WebAug 16, 2024 · Novel Farms is a food-tech company that aims to create gourmet, cultured meat in an ethical and sustainable manner, to positively impact and evolve the current food system. Novel Farms solves the structuring problem of cultivated meat by developing a proprietary microbial fermentation approach to produce low-cost, edible, and highly ... WebAug 23, 2024 · Novel Farms plans to use the additional growth capital to expand their team, move operations from lab to pilot scale, and scale the production of their structured cell based meat products through 2024-2024. Novel Farms' signature product line will include whole cuts of premium meats such as Iberian pork and dry-cured Iberian ham.
